An exercise cycle static bike exercise, also referred to as a stationary bike, is a piece of physical fitness equipment created to mimic the action of biking in a controlled environment. Unlike standard biking, stationary bikes allow users to exercise without the requirement for roads, weather conditions, or surface. They are available in numerous forms, each accommodating different physical fitness objectives and choices.

viavito-onyx-folding-exercise-bike-black-1364.jpgKinds Of Exercise Cycle Bikes
Upright Bikes

Description: Resemble a standard road bike with a vertical position and handlebars.
Benefits: Ideal for cardiovascular workouts, muscle toning, and improving general fitness.
Usage: Suitable for both beginners and advanced users.
Recumbent Bikes

Description: Feature a reclined position with a back-rest and a bigger seat for added comfort.
Benefits: Reduce pressure on the back and knees, making them ideal for people with joint problems or those who choose a more unwinded trip.
Use: Great for low-impact exercises and rehab.
Spin Bikes

Description: Designed for high-intensity period training (HIIT) and spinning classes, with features like adjustable resistance and speed.
Advantages: Excellent for burning calories and developing endurance.
Use: Popular in health clubs and group fitness settings.
Dual Action Bikes

Description: Incorporate both limb motions, supplying a full-body workout.
Benefits: Enhance cardiovascular health, muscle tone, and coordination.
Use: Ideal for those seeking a comprehensive physical fitness regimen.
Key Benefits of Using an Exercise Cycle bike home exercise
Cardiovascular Health

Routine usage of a cycle bike can substantially improve heart health by increasing cardiovascular endurance and lowering the threat of heart illness.
Biking is a low-impact activity that puts minimal tension on the joints, making it ideal for people of all ages and fitness levels.
Weight Management

Biking burns a considerable number of calories, assisting in weight-loss and upkeep.
It can be adjusted to match various fitness levels, from gentle pedaling to intense interval training.
Muscle Strengthening and Toning

The pedaling motion engages significant muscle groups, including the quadriceps, hamstrings, calves, and glutes.
Some bikes, like double action designs, likewise target the upper body, offering a more well balanced workout.
Improved Mental Health

Exercise, including biking, releases endorphins, which can help lower stress, stress and anxiety, and anxiety.
The recurring movement of cycling can be meditative, promoting a sense of calm and focus.
Flexibility in Workout

Stationary bikes can be used in numerous settings, including at bicycle home exercise, in a health club, or in a fitness class.
They use a wide variety of resistance levels and programs, allowing users to tailor their workouts.
Rehabilitation and Therapy

Recumbent bikes, in specific, are helpful for people recuperating from injuries or handling chronic discomfort.
They offer a low-impact, low-stress way to maintain or restore strength and movement.
Tips for Effective Workouts on an Exercise Cycle Bike
Correct Setup

Adjust the seat height so that your legs are somewhat bent at the bottom of the pedal stroke.
Make sure the handlebars are at a comfortable height and distance to avoid strain on your back and shoulders.
Warm-Up and Cool-Down

Start with a 5-10 minute warm-up at a moderate rate to prepare your muscles and heart for exercise.
End up with a 5-10 minute cool-down to gradually lower your heart rate and avoid muscle stiffness.
Incorporate Variety

Switch between different types of exercises, such as steady-state cardio, interval training, and hill climbs, to keep your regular appealing and tough.
Utilize the pre-programmed exercises or create your own to suit your fitness goals.
Monitor Your Progress

Numerous cycle bikes include built-in screens that track metrics like distance, speed, resistance, and calories burned.
Regularly inspect these metrics to evaluate your enhancements and change your workouts appropriately.
Stay Hydrated and Comfortable

Keep a water bottle close by to remain hydrated during your exercise.
Use comfortable, moisture-wicking clothing to boost your comfort and performance.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s).
1. What is the very best type of exercise cycle bike for novices?

For novices, an upright bike is a good choice as it provides a familiar cycling position and a moderate level of strength. Recumbent bikes are also exceptional, particularly for those with back or knee problems, as they provide a more comfy and low-impact trip.
2. How frequently should I utilize an exercise cycle bike?

For optimal health benefits, aim to use the cycle bike 3-5 times each week. Each session ought to last in between 20-60 minutes, depending upon your physical fitness level and goals.
3. Can biking on a stationary bike assist with weight-loss?

Yes, cycling can be a reliable method to burn calories and contribute to weight reduction. A 150-pound individual can burn approximately 250-400 calories per hour, depending upon the intensity of the workout.
4. Is it safe to use a cycle bike if I have joint issues?

Recumbent bikes are generally more secure for individuals with joint problems due to their low-impact nature and supportive style. However, it's always a good idea to speak with a doctor before starting any new exercise routine.
5. How can I make my biking exercises more difficult?

Increase the resistance level on your bike to imitate hill climbing.
Try period training, rotating between high-intensity bursts and recovery periods.
Use the bike's pre-programmed workouts or produce your own to keep your regular fresh and difficult.
6. What are some common errors to prevent when utilizing an leg exercise machine cycle bike?

Poor Posture: Ensure your back is straight and your core is engaged to avoid stress.
Overtraining: Gradually increase the intensity and duration of your workouts to prevent burnout and injury.
Disregarding Warm-Up and Cool-Down: Always begin with a warm-up and end with a cool-down to avoid muscle discomfort and improve healing.
7. Can I use a cycle bike for strength training?

While cycle bikes are primarily developed for cardiovascular exercise, you can incorporate strength training aspects by utilizing higher resistance levels and concentrating on particular muscle groups. Double action bikes, which engage both the upper and lower body, are especially reliable for this purpose.
